What is GOOGLEFINANCE in Google Sheets?

GOOGLEFINANCE connects your sheet to Google market data. Pass a ticker symbol, an attribute like price or volume, and optional date range arguments for historical quotes. Portfolio trackers and FX dashboards use it to avoid manual price copy-paste.

When to use it

Use GOOGLEFINANCE for simple stock quotes, mutual fund NAV, currency conversion, or historical price series on a personal or team dashboard.

When to skip it

Skip GOOGLEFINANCE for licensed real-time trading feeds, exotic instruments Google does not list, or compliance-grade audit trails. Paid data vendors may be required.

How it works

  1. 1

    Enter a ticker such as GOOGLEFINANCE("AAPL", "price") for the latest price.

  2. 2

    Swap the attribute argument for open, high, low, volume, pe, or marketcap as needed.

  3. 3

    Add start and end dates plus a daily or weekly interval for historical tables.

  4. 4

    Use GOOGLEFINANCE("CURRENCY:USDEUR") for exchange rates in finance models.

  5. 5

    Leave room for historical queries to spill multiple rows of date and close columns.

  6. 6

    Document that delays and symbol coverage follow Google Finance policies, not your broker.

Examples in Google Sheets

Live price column

=GOOGLEFINANCE(A2, "price") down a list of tickers in column A fills current prices in column B.

USD to EUR rate

=GOOGLEFINANCE("CURRENCY:USDEUR") supplies a spot rate for invoice conversion.

One-year history

=GOOGLEFINANCE("MSFT", "close", TODAY()-365, TODAY()) returns dated closing prices for a chart.

Common mistakes

  • Using wrong exchange prefixes for international tickers, which returns #N/A.
  • Expecting after-hours prints to match your brokerage platform exactly.
  • Building margin calls on GOOGLEFINANCE without understanding update delays.
  • Mixing attribute names; "price" vs "close" behave differently on historical calls.
  • Referencing delisted symbols and not handling #N/A in downstream formulas.

Frequently asked questions

Is GOOGLEFINANCE real-time?
It is delayed market data suitable for dashboards, not a live trading feed.
GOOGLEFINANCE for crypto?
Some crypto pairs work with CURRENCY or specific symbols. Coverage changes over time.
Why #N/A on a valid ticker?
Wrong market prefix, typo, or Google dropped support for that symbol.
Can GOOGLEFINANCE return dividends?
Some attributes expose yield or company info. Check current attribute list in Google help.
Historical data limits?
Very long ranges may truncate or slow recalc. Test your date window.
GOOGLEFINANCE vs IMPORTXML?
GOOGLEFINANCE is built for market data. IMPORTXML scrapes arbitrary web pages.
Multiple tickers at once?
Use one formula per row or ARRAYFORMULA with a ticker list in a column.
